Asivad Anac said:It does matter.
You will have to conclusively prove to CIC that you haven't borrowed the funds to showcase as POF. In your case, that would probably mean sending out additional information to CIC in the form of either opening/closing balances of each of the last 6 months (showing a gradual increase and no sudden large credits) or 6 months of bank statements (showing the same gradual increase in a detailed manner). Along with that, add an LOE highlighting that you've been consciously saving up on the funds to showcase as POF. And hope for a sympathetic, non-arbitrary officer to be assigned to your application who would ask questions/clarifications when in doubt.
